Jennifer Rose Pries started dancing at the age of two at Tina Marie’s School Dance in Shelby Township, Michigan. At the age of six she joined the competition team where she fell in love with dance. She has training in Jazz, Tap, Ballet, Lyrical, Contemporary, Musical Theatre, and Hip Hop. At age 12 she started assisting teachers  and began her teaching/choreography career at the age of 16.  During her competition life she won many titles including the prestigious Miss National StarQuest 2016. Shortly after graduating High School, she moved to New York City to be part of The Broadway Dance Center Professional Program where she focused her study in Musical Theatre. Once she completed this program she began auditioning, performing, and teaching in New York City.  Jennifer has also been a teacher at Michigan Theatre Festival for 6 years. She also was a part of Axelrod Theater’s “High School Musical” The Musical.  Her most recent contract was in Busch Gardens Williamsburg, where she was the ballerina in the Oktoberfest show. Jennifer has taken her love for teaching to The Academy Of Dance and Gymnastics.  She is excited to be a part of this special dance family.
